How should I choose the right Bluetooth earbuds warranty for my needs?
The best approach is to align warranty length, coverage details, and service options with how you plan to use the earbuds. Look for who backs the warranty (brand vs. retailer), what counts as a defect or failure, whether water resistance or accidental damage is covered, and how easy it is to claim or arrange a replacement.
What does a typical 2-year Bluetooth earbuds warranty cover, and what should I watch out for?
A 2-year bluetooth earbuds warranty usually covers manufacturing defects that affect performance under normal use, with proof of purchase required for a claim. It may exclude water damage, cosmetic wear, misuse, and unauthorized repairs; check if protections include water resistance or accidental damage, and note the claims process and service locations.

What maintenance or compatibility steps help protect your Bluetooth earbuds warranty?
Follow manufacturer guidelines for charging, cleaning, and storage to prevent issues that could void the bluetooth earbuds warranty. Use only approved accessories and avoid attempting repairs yourself, as unauthorized work is commonly excluded. Keep your receipt and register the product if required so you can file a claim quickly with the right device compatibility and service options.
How do I claim a Bluetooth earbuds warranty, and what should I check before buying?
To claim a bluetooth earbuds warranty, start by confirming who backs the coverage (brand or retailer) and whether it is transferable. Keep your proof of purchase and register the product if required, as these details speed up the claim process. Review exclusions (water damage, misuse, unauthorized repairs) and note the available service options and timelines to plan accordingly.
